White primer (I'd suggest Tamiya White Fine, just found out how nice that is.)
Either Shadow Grey or Space Wolf Grey as washes.
Vallejo Model Colour Flat Aluminium
Vallejo Airbrish Colour White.

Use a dark grey in the flexibile joints of the arms and legs and you should be good to go.

I actually like to use a sakrua micron pen to do fine black edge work.
http://www.sakuraofamerica.com/Pen-Archival

My process is quick white coat ( no primer ) coat of badab black. Then build the white back up with thin layers. Finally touch up joints and edges with the pen when needed. Nice clean, almost storm trooper look.
